This special holiday workshop introduces the magic of reductive printmaking, a technique where you progressively carve a single linoleum block to create a two-color design. You’ll learn a new skill and leave with ten beautiful handmade cards! No drawing or printmaking experience required. Class Outline:

  1. Design & Transfer: Introduction to reductive printmaking, adapting your holiday design, and transferring it to the block.

  2. First Layer: Carving the areas for your first color, mixing ink, and printing the first layer onto your cards.

  3. Second Layer: Further carving the same block for the second color, then printing over your first layer to complete the image.

  4. Wrap-Up: Review, tips for drying your cards, and Q&A about printing more at home.
